Fat-Free & Low Fat Foods
FACT: When a company puts out a low-fat or 💯 fat-free option, they often add MORE SUGAR to make up for the lost flavor that came from fats.
For example, if you buy a “healthy” fat free yogurt or low-fat salad dressing, you are likely consuming MORE sugar (and sometimes just as many calories) than when you were eating the real fully leaded stuff. So, it’s actually better to just have less of the real stuff than a lot of the ‘healthy’ substitute.
TIP: Instead of flavored low-fat yogurts, get plain yogurt and add fresh fruit to it. Instead of getting low-fat salad dressing, make your own so you have more control over what you are putting into your body.

Pantry Foods
Lastly, there are TONS of sugar in things you would NEVER dream should even have sugar in them. Soup, spaghetti sauce, condiments, bread, crackers, wraps, granola, cereal, instant oatmeal and countless other items that come from the ‘center aisles” at the grocery store.

Even healthy frozen dinners add sugar to make their meals taste better. And it doesn’t stop there.
Fast food restaurants event put sugar in their 🍟 salty french fries or “healthier” sides, like green beans, to make them taste better.
